Providing precise analog voltage distribution within integrated control systems, the Honeywell TC-0AV081 serves as a high-density, 8-channel analog output module designed specifically for the Logix 5000 platform. This Honeywell-badged module is fully compatible with standard chassis architectures, enabling seamless integration into DCS and industrial automation systems. It translates digital control variables from the controller memory into highly accurate analog voltage signals to drive control valves, actuators, and speed reference inputs on variable frequency drives.

The Honeywell TC-0AV081 is functional-equivalent to standard Allen-Bradley ControlLogix 1756 voltage output modules. However, in Honeywell Experion PKS configurations, you must ensure the system's firmware package includes the correct Honeywell hardware definitions to recognize the TC-0AV081 identity code properly during chassis discovery.
When utilizing voltage outputs over long distances, line resistance drop can alter the signal level received at the actuator. If your wiring paths exceed 100 meters, monitor for voltage attenuation and compensate within your controller scaling or transition to isolated current loop converters where applicable to maintain precise positioning accuracy.
For clean signals free of electromagnetic noise, use individually shielded twisted-pair cabling for each voltage channel. The shield must be connected to a clean instrument ground point strictly at the chassis end of the cable run; leaving the shield floating or grounding both ends can generate ground loops that distort your analog output values.
Ensure that all external field-side voltage loops are completely de-energized and verified with a calibrated multimeter before attaching or removing the field wiring terminal block. Although the module support RIUP backplane communication, hot-wiring active high-energy analog loops can damage delicate on-board digital-to-analog converters (DACs).
Align the module circuit board with the upper and lower guide rails of the designated slot in the rack.
Slide the module firmly into the chassis until the top and bottom locking tabs audibly click and lock into place.
Attach the pre-wired Removable Terminal Block (RTB) to the front interface, secure the housing screws, and apply field loop power.
